Questions You Should Ask Your Mechanic

When it comes to car maintenance and repair, it pays to know what you’re getting into. Here at Green Light Auto Credit, we recommend you be prepared to ask your mechanic some important questions before any work is done. These are the questions we think every driver should be ready to ask:

  • What Are My Repair Options? – If your car needs work, you probably have more than one option — even if the mechanic doesn’t mention it — and you deserve to know what they are. You can ask about the cost of all available options, and even refuse service.
  • What Certifications Do You Have? – If you’re going to a mechanic and you aren’t sure whether you should trust them or not, you can ask about certifications. The Automobile Service Excellence Certification is given to technicians that are at the top of the industry, so check for that first.
  • Can You Provide a Maintenance Plan? – Mechanics should be able to tell you what steps you need to take after a repair to keep everything running like new.
  • What Kind of Warranty Do You Offer? – A reputable shop should be able to provide some kind of warranty or guarantee of their work. If they can’t do that, then you might want to consider going elsewhere.
  • Can I See the Parts That Were Replaced? – If you needed parts replaced ask to see the used or broken ones. This is a good way to check to see that parts were really replaced, and it’s a good way to learn about what work was done.
